C. Teresa Hurley of North Main St. Andover, Ma, passed away suddenly on October 9, 2009 at age 87. Being a lifelong resident of Andover she was well known for her amusingly feisty nature and a tactful wit. Teresa enjoyed sitting on her front porch greeting the occasional honking car with a wave and a “who the heck was that”. For decades her home was a landmark to many and her passing will leave a void with all who loved her. She attended St Augustine school and Graduated from Punchard High in 1939 being the captain of the basketball team for three years. She retired from Tyer Rubber after 30 years of service producing deep sea diving suits. She then worked at Market Basket in Andover where she taught the younger workers the value of dedication and hard work. She enjoyed volunteering at Bread and Roses in Lawrence MA serving food to the homeless and needy. She was also a lifelong member of St Augustine Parish in Andover.
